Common use of RESPECT Clause in Contracts

RESPECT. All employees will be treated with respect by supervisors, managers and other employees of the Employer. Bullying will not be tolerated. The Employer will follow a formal complaint process, investigate complaints submitted in accordance with the policy, and take action it determines is appropriate to ensure compliance with this article. If any of the following occur, an employee may file a grievance at Step 2: The Employer fails to investigate, make findings and take such action as it deems appropriate within thirty (30) days of the filing of the complaint (such timeline may be extended by mutual agreement based on the circumstances of the investigation); the Employer finds that the complaint is not substantiated; or the Employer’s action does not result in a cessation of conduct in violation of this article. In the case of an arbitration over whether or not a complaint is substantiated, the Arbitrator’s authority is limited to finding that the complaint should have been substantiated and directing the Employer to take action it determines is appropriate to ensure compliance with this article.
